Can Portland Trail Blazers Harness Home Advantage Against LA Clippers?

As the Portland Trail Blazers prepare to host the LA Clippers at the Moda Center, fans are eager to see if their team can capitalize on home court advantage. The Trail Blazers have had a challenging season, with their recent performance against the Boston Celtics resulting in a 99-121 loss. Despite this, there were positive takeaways, including a perfect free throw percentage and a solid three-point shooting rate of thirty-six percent.

The game against the Toronto Raptors showed more promise for Portland with an overtime victory of 128-118. The team's offensive efforts were notable, achieving forty-eight percent from the field and forty percent from beyond the arc. Their defensive play also improved as they managed to keep their opponents' scoring under control in crucial moments.


However, consistency remains an issue for Portland as seen in their encounter with Houston Rockets where they fell short at 107-123. The Trail Blazers struggled defensively, allowing one hundred twenty-three points and losing by sixteen points despite putting up a fight offensively.

Looking ahead to their matchup with the Clippers, Portland will need to focus on maintaining strong defense while exploiting any weaknesses in Los Angeles' armor. With home support behind them at Moda Center and recent glimpses of potential during high-scoring periods against formidable opponents like Boston and Toronto, there is hope that they can turn things around.


Fans can catch all the action live on March 22nd at 7:00 PM local time on ROOT Sports NW+ or BSSC networks as both teams battle it out on court in what promises to be an exciting game filled with strategic plays and intense competition.
